The Animation/Video for Multimedia diploma program at Shoreline Community College provides students with the essential skills and knowledge needed for a successful career in the rapidly evolving field of multimedia design. The program covers a wide array of topics including 2D and 3D animation, video production, and editing, allowing students to create engaging content for various platforms. Through hands-on projects, students learn to use industry-standard software and tools to bring their creative visions to life.
The course is structured to offer a comprehensive blend of theoretical foundations and practical application. Students will engage in collaborative projects, which mimic real-world working conditions, fostering teamwork and communication skills. Classes focus on storytelling techniques, visual design principles, and the technical aspects of animation and video production.

Prospective students should have a high school diploma or equivalent educational background. A portfolio showcasing previous work and creative projects may be required, demonstrating a passion for multimedia design and animation. Additionally, basic computer skills and familiarity with digital media are advantageous.
International students should typically demonstrate English proficiency through standardized tests. An IELTS score of 6.0 or a TOEFL score of around 60-70 is often considered acceptable, but it is advisable to consult the official guidelines for specific requirements.
